As a web developer, staying up-to-date with the latest technologies, tools, and best practices is crucial. One way to streamline this process is by leveraging curated resources that offer a wealth of information and inspiration 링크모음. Whether you’re a beginner or an experienced developer, these top link collection resources will help you enhance your skills, find solutions to challenges, and discover new tools that can make your development process more efficient.
1. MDN Web Docs (Mozilla Developer Network)
is one of the most comprehensive and trusted resources for web developers. The site covers HTML, CSS, JavaScript, and other web technologies in great detail, offering tutorials, references, and code examples. Whether you’re looking to brush up on a specific concept or explore a new one, MDN provides clear and reliable documentation for both beginners and advanced users.
- Why it’s great: Detailed, up-to-date, and beginner-friendly.
- Best for: Understanding web standards, coding best practices, and troubleshooting.
2. CSS-Tricks
CSS-Tricks is a fantastic resource for all things related to CSS, but it also covers other web development topics such as JavaScript, design patterns, and front-end frameworks. With hundreds of tutorials, articles, and a popular “Almanac” section, CSS-Tricks is invaluable for developers looking to improve their skills in both design and development.
- Why it’s great: A large collection of tutorials, tips, and design advice.
- Best for: Learning advanced CSS techniques and UI/UX design principles.
3. A List Apart
A List Apart focuses on web standards and the design and development of websites. The articles here often dive into topics such as accessibility, responsive design, and user experience. If you’re interested in creating websites that are both functional and user-friendly, this is the place for you.
- Why it’s great: Thoughtful, in-depth articles on web standards and user-centric design.
- Best for: Learning about accessibility, UX, and web design principles.
4. Smashing Magazine
Smashing Magazine is a well-known resource for web developers and designers, offering in-depth articles, tutorials, and books on a variety of topics. From front-end development to web performance and mobile-first design, Smashing Magazine covers it all. The magazine also regularly releases eBooks and organizes workshops for developers.
- Why it’s great: Comprehensive coverage of both design and development topics.
- Best for: Gaining insights on web performance, design trends, and development techniques.
5. Dev.to
Dev.to is an online community of developers that share articles, tutorials, and discussions on programming, web development, and software engineering. The platform is user-friendly and allows you to follow specific tags (e.g., JavaScript, CSS, React) to tailor the content to your interests. Whether you’re looking for quick tips or in-depth guides, Dev.to has something for everyone.
- Why it’s great: A supportive, community-driven platform with a wide variety of content.
- Best for: Learning from other developers and staying up-to-date with new technologies.
6. Frontend Masters
Frontend Masters is an online learning platform that provides high-quality courses for web developers, with a focus on front-end technologies like JavaScript, React, CSS, and more. Their expert-led courses dive deep into topics, giving you the skills you need to level up your development career.
- Why it’s great: In-depth, professional-quality courses.
- Best for: Gaining expertise in modern web development frameworks and tools.
7. Stack Overflow
Stack Overflow is a go-to resource for developers when they need help solving coding problems. Whether you’re troubleshooting a bug or seeking advice on a best practice, Stack Overflow has a vast community of developers who can help you find answers quickly. You can search for previously answered questions or post your own queries to get feedback from other professionals.
- Why it’s great: Extensive Q&A format with community support for a wide range of topics.
- Best for: Troubleshooting coding problems and finding solutions to specific issues.
8. GitHub
GitHub is more than just a code repository. It’s also a treasure trove of open-source projects, libraries, and frameworks. Browsing GitHub repositories can help you discover new tools or gain inspiration for your own projects. Additionally, GitHub Pages allows you to host static websites directly from your repository, making it a great resource for developers working with front-end technologies.
- Why it’s great: Collaboration, open-source projects, and an enormous codebase for reference.
- Best for: Discovering open-source projects and hosting your own code.
9. Web.dev
Web.dev by Google offers excellent resources for web developers who want to improve the performance, accessibility, and SEO of their websites. The site provides tutorials, audits, and articles based on modern best practices, with a strong focus on web performance and user experience.
- Why it’s great: A rich resource for improving web performance and compliance with web standards.
- Best for: Developers focused on optimizing their websites for speed and accessibility.
10. CodePen
CodePen is an online code editor and social development environment where developers can showcase their HTML, CSS, and JavaScript skills. It’s a great resource for trying out new ideas, seeing what others are building, and getting inspiration for your own projects. CodePen is also home to a large community of front-end developers sharing their experiments.
- Why it’s great: Instant feedback on code and access to a vast collection of front-end experiments.
- Best for: Experimenting with new web technologies and sharing your creations with others.
Conclusion
As a web developer, using the right resources can significantly enhance your workflow, knowledge, and ability to stay current with the evolving landscape of web development. These top link collection resources provide a blend of documentation, tutorials, community-driven insights, and inspiration to help you grow your skills and build better websites. Whether you’re looking to learn something new, troubleshoot a problem, or collaborate with others, these resources have you covered.